Overview of the United States Sodium-air Battery Market

The United States sodium-air battery market is experiencing significant growth driven by advancements in battery technology and increasing demand for sustainable energy solutions. Sodium-air batteries are gaining attention as potential alternatives to lithium-ion batteries due to their higher energy density and lower cost. These batteries operate by using oxygen from the air to react with sodium, producing energy and sodium oxide as a byproduct.

There are several types of sodium-air batteries being developed and deployed in the US market. These include aqueous and non-aqueous variants, each with unique characteristics suited for different applications. Aqueous sodium-air batteries typically use water-based electrolytes, offering simplicity and safety, while non-aqueous versions use organic solvents, providing potentially higher energy densities and efficiency.

The market segmentation of sodium-air batteries in the US can be categorized based on their application areas. These batteries are being explored for use in electric vehicles (EVs), grid-scale energy storage systems, and portable electronics. The versatility of sodium-air batteries makes them attractive across various sectors, promising a sustainable and efficient energy storage solution.
